英文摘要
In a mouse model of cutaneous ischemia-reperfusion injury, local administration of anti-TNF-α antibody and 1400W inhibited expression of inducible nitric oxide synthase and cytotoxicity of TNF-α From that reason, I suggest that anti-TNF-α antibody treatment might prevent the pressure ulcers.
